Miller is a multifaceted professional whose career spans medicine, pageantry, and acting. As a trauma surgery physician assistant, she has been a staunch advocate for trauma injury prevention. Her commitment to public health extends beyond the hospital; as a contestant in the Miss America pageant system, she utilized her platform to promote injury prevention and the American Heart Association. Transitioning from medicine to the arts, Amanda pursued her passion for performance as an actress and can be seen in roles in television and film on Apple TV, Hulu, Amazon Prime and CBS. Her medical expertise has enriched her acting, allowing her to bring authenticity to roles. Her journey exemplifies a seamless blend of science and art, showcasing her versatility and dedication to impacting lives both on and off the screen. Amanda is the founder of The Pageant RX, a healthcare initiative tailored to the unique wellness needs of pageant contestants and industry professionals. Drawing from her own experiences in pageantry and medicine, she launched this platform to provide accessible, informed healthcare support to those in the industry. The Pageant RX has been recognized as an invaluable resource, with organizations like Miss America and Miss USA praising Amanda for her understanding and support of pageant women’s health and wellness needs. Her dedication to this cause underscores her commitment to empowering individuals in the pageant community through comprehensive healthcare solutions.

In 2006, in her very first foray into the world of beauty pageant competitions, Shilah made history and was crowned the first African American woman to reign as Miss Texas in its 70-year history. She went on to become the 1st runner up to Miss America 2007. Shilah used her scholarship money to complete her Bachelor’s degree at the world renowned Grammy winning Jazz Studies program at the University of North Texas. Women who want to learn more from Heather Sumlin and our guests may also enjoy the She Wins Solutions for Women Patreon Channel - Find Heather Sumlin Patreon - Website - Instagram - FaceBook - Find Elaine Welbourn FaceBook - Instagram - Photography Website - Elaine's Bio: Elaine's love of Dog Agility started from the highchair. As a toddler she sat feeding Goldfish crackers to the family Springer Spaniel while her mother walked the course. At the age of 10 years while most of her classmates played hockey and baseball she competed as a junior handler with a beautiful Rough Collie, “Shady", and taught private lessons in the sport from her backyard. In high school Elaine found a new passion for digital arts and photography which lead her to complete a university degree in Media Communications and build a successful wedding photography business. "Life Turns Corners" In 2016 Elaine purchased her first home and the first dog of her own -- a Shetland Sheepdog she registered under this name to honour her mother's favourite words of wisdom. “Ryder” inspired her to come back to the dog world and reignite her passion for training and competing first and foremost in Agility, but also in the sports of Scent Detection, CKC Obedience, Dock Diving, and Rally Obedience. Later Elaine’s family grew as she added rescue mixed breed “Tanner”, sweet-natured Shetland Sheepdog “Maverick”, and wild-child Australian Koolie “Zephyr” to the pack. In 2020 amidst the Covid-19 pandemic Elaine connected with a local puppy owner looking for advice raising her first sports dog. Online training sessions almost every day grew into a treasured friendship and the inspiration for Dream Higher Agility Coaching. Now in 2024 Elaine coaches an incredible group of dedicated, passionate dog handlers who make her life more fulfilled just by existing in it. Her students range from excited pet owners wanting to build a stronger relationship with their dogs to several currently working toward the goal of competing at national and international events. Of course, as ‘life turns corners’, Elaine competed for Agility Team Canada in England while eagerly awaiting another new addition; her puppy “Luca” who joined the family in August 2024.
